Key Smart Home Wiring Tips for Beginners
If you're new to smart home tech, start with these foundational tips to ensure a smooth installation:
- Assess Your Electrical Panel: Before adding smart devices, have your panel inspected. Older Decatur homes, especially in areas like Downtown or Oakhurst, may need upgrades to handle increased loads. Our elderly home electrical safety checks can identify issues early.
- Choose the Right Wiring Type: Opt for Cat6 or fiber optic cables for high-speed data transmission. Low-voltage wiring is ideal for smart lights and sensors, reducing energy use while maintaining performance.
- Plan for Centralized Control: Install a central hub in a convenient location, like your living room. This allows easy access and minimizes cable clutter throughout your home.

Advanced Wiring Strategies for Tech Enthusiasts
For those ready to level up, advanced wiring opens doors to whole-home automation. Here's how to do it right:
- Structured Wiring Systems: Run dedicated conduits for Ethernet, HDMI, and power lines. This future-proofs your home against emerging tech like 8K streaming or AI assistants.
- Powerline Adapters vs. Dedicated Lines: While adapters use existing wiring, dedicated lines offer superior reliability. In larger Decatur homes in Indian Creek or McDonough, dedicated setups prevent signal drops.
